Commission can hear Nauru claims


Human rights groups say the royal commission investigating institutional responses to child abuse has the power to examine allegations of abuse and neglect of asylum seekers on Nauru. Three groups, headed by the Human Rights Law Centre, today released legal advice backing their claim. The advice was given to the royal commission a year ago after it ruled it could not investigate events in another country. Marc Purcell from the Council for International Development urged the commission to accept the legal advice. The move follows the leaking of 2000 critical incident reports which detail abuse, self-harm and neglect claims by asylum seekers.
